The aims of this research are to validate and develop of therapeutic strategies for patients with colorectal lesions in real time through pCLE(probe-based confocal laser endomicroscopy). Endomicroscopy is a technique for obtaining histology-like images from inside the human body in real-time. Total objections are 311 patients.
Specific research topics are as below.
The study will be conducted to measure sensitivity, specificity, accuracy, amphoteric predict of pCLE diagnosis, and calculate the agreement of prediction compared to the pathological findings of lesions Check diagnostic agreement of technical phrases which are derived, the matching degree between observers, and will develope a new classification method based on this.

| probe-based confocal laser endomicroscopy | Procedure | After shooting 10% fluorescein sodium in,2.5-5 .0 ml to the object with colorectal disease, the lesion will observed and evaluated with pCLE in real-time and also stored the inspection images. Then, determines the treatment plan to determine which is applied currently in clinical, Sensitivity, specificity, accuracy, amphoteric predict of pCLE diagnosis, and calculate the agreement of prediction compared to the pathological findings of lesions Based on the inspection image stored, using Delphi approach tests, two or more are discussed, to derive a significant technical phrases. Check diagnostic agreement of technical phrases which are derived, the matching degree between observers, and developed a new classification method based on this. |
